The attire of female athletes, particularly in sports like cross country running, has sparked significant debate and discussion over the years. One of the most controversial aspects is the choice of wearing bikini-style uniforms. This article delves into the reasons why many female cross country runners opt for these revealing outfits, exploring the intersection of comfort, performance, societal expectations, and the ongoing conversation about gender equality in sports.

Why Do Cross Country Women Runners Wear Bikinis

The Evolution of Athletic Attire

Historical Context

The evolution of women's athletic wear has been influenced by various factors, including societal norms, fashion trends, and the demands of specific sports. In the early 20th century, women were often restricted to conservative clothing that limited their movement. However, as women began to participate more actively in sports, there was a gradual shift towards more functional attire. This transition was not without its challenges, as many women faced criticism for wearing clothing deemed too masculine or revealing.

The Bikini's Introduction

The bikini itself was introduced in 1946 and was initially considered scandalous. Over time, it became a symbol of freedom and body positivity. In sports, particularly those played in warm climates or on sandy surfaces, such as beach volleyball and handball, bikini-style uniforms became prevalent due to their perceived comfort and practicality. These uniforms were often seen as a necessary compromise between modesty and performance.

Comfort and Performance

Aerodynamics and Mobility

One of the primary reasons female runners choose bikini-style uniforms is related to comfort and performance. Many athletes argue that less fabric allows for greater mobility and reduces the risk of chafing during long runs. According to Jennifer Kessy, a former Olympic beach volleyball player, wearing a one-piece suit can be restrictive and uncomfortable when competing on sand. This sentiment is echoed by many cross country runners who prefer lighter clothing for its ability to enhance their performance.

Temperature Regulation

In cross country running, where races often take place in varying weather conditions, lighter clothing can help regulate body temperature. Athletes may feel more comfortable wearing minimal clothing during hot summer races, allowing them to focus on their performance rather than their attire. This is particularly important in endurance sports, where even small factors can significantly impact overall performance.

Psychological Impact

Beyond physical comfort, wearing preferred attire can also have a psychological impact on athletes. Feeling confident and comfortable in what they wear can boost an athlete's morale and enhance their competitive edge. This psychological aspect is often overlooked but is crucial in high-pressure sports environments.

Societal Expectations and Gender Norms

The Sexualization of Female Athletes

Despite the practical reasons for wearing bikinis, there is an underlying issue of sexualization in women's sports. Many critics argue that revealing uniforms contribute to the objectification of female athletes. Angela Schneider, an Olympic silver medallist, has emphasized that athletic wear should enhance performance rather than draw attention to the athlete's body. This perspective highlights the tension between functional attire and societal expectations.

The Double Standard

The double standard in athletic attire is evident when comparing men's and women's uniforms. While male athletes often wear longer shorts or loose-fitting clothing without scrutiny, female athletes are frequently expected to wear more revealing outfits. This disparity raises questions about the motivations behind uniform regulations and whether they are rooted in outdated gender norms. The Norwegian women's beach handball team's decision to wear shorts instead of bikini bottoms during a match sparked a global conversation about these disparities.

Media Coverage

Media coverage also plays a significant role in shaping public perceptions of female athletes' attire. The way athletes are presented in media can either reinforce or challenge societal norms. For instance, focusing on an athlete's performance rather than their appearance can help shift the narrative towards a more inclusive and respectful dialogue.

Pushback Against Revealing Attire

Recent Movements

In recent years, there has been a growing movement among female athletes to challenge the status quo regarding uniform requirements. The Norwegian women's beach handball team made headlines when they were fined for wearing shorts instead of bikini bottoms during a match. This incident highlighted the ongoing struggle for female athletes to have autonomy over their attire. Such movements are crucial in pushing for change and challenging outdated regulations.

Empowerment Through Choice

Many athletes express a desire for choice in their uniforms rather than being mandated to wear specific styles. British Paralympian Olivia Breen has spoken out against criticism for her choice of sprint briefs, emphasizing that they are designed for performance. This sentiment resonates with many female athletes who want to prioritize comfort while competing. The ability to choose their attire empowers athletes to focus on their sport rather than societal expectations.

FAQ

1. Why do some female runners prefer bikini-style uniforms?

Female runners often prefer bikini-style uniforms because they provide greater mobility and comfort during races, especially in warm weather conditions.

2. Are bikini uniforms required for all female athletes?

No, bikini uniforms are not universally required; many sports allow female athletes to choose from various options based on personal preference and comfort.

3. What are some criticisms of bikini-style athletic wear?

Critics argue that bikini-style athletic wear contributes to the sexualization of female athletes and perpetuates a double standard compared to male athletes' uniforms.

4. How have recent movements impacted uniform regulations?

Recent movements have led to increased awareness about gender disparities in athletic attire, prompting some organizations to reconsider uniform regulations and allow more options for female athletes.

5. What role does temperature play in choosing athletic wear?

Temperature plays a significant role as lighter clothing can help regulate body heat during races, making it more comfortable for athletes competing in hot conditions.
